Alpine Pika vs Dunkler Fruchtvampir
Ochotona alpina compared with Artibeus obscurus
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Alpine Pika | Dunkler Fruchtvampir |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Tier) | Animalia (Tier)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ordatiere) | Chordata (Chordatiere)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Säugetiere) | Mammalia (Säugetiere) |
| Order | Lagomorpha (Hasenartige) | Chiroptera (Fledertiere) |
| Family | Ochotonidae | Phyllostomidae |
| Genus | Ochotona | Artibeus |
| Species | Ochotona alpina | Artibeus obscurus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Alpine Pika and Dunkler Fruchtvampir share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Säugetiere)
